Can high-order dependencies improve mutual information based feature selection?
Mutual information (MI) based approaches are a popular paradigm for feature selection. Most previous methods have made use of low-dimensional MI quantities that are only effective at detecting low-order dependencies between variables. This paper uses the tools of information theory to examine and reason about the information content of the attributes within a relation instance. For two sets of attributes, an information dependency measure (InD measure) characterizes the uncertainty remaining about the values for the second set when the values for the rst set are known. We propose a novel local appearance modeling method for object detection and recognition in cluttered scenes. The approach is based on the joint distribution of local feature vectors at multiple salient points and their factorization with Independent Component Analysis (ICA).
